Output 61c34aebc69c4a0b4fe65374cc9f7e737c0ace4acd04a9e8061b495c7f9d0016:0

value
271680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ef4d779ae7810149c8d5dbd529b22e19b723cf5 OP_EQUAL
address
3DGJNcZfFK4NpQiGSyMo7ewdPu94X6yKi7
transaction
61c34aebc69c4a0b4fe65374cc9f7e737c0ace4acd04a9e8061b495c7f9d0016
spent
true